How Accurate is Zillow in your Home Evaluation?



Selling In SEA BRIGHT - LONG BRANCH AREA? Get a free home value report.  Purchasing a home at the Jersey Shore? Click here for full MLS access.

As a real estate professional I constantly get bombarded by "Why is Zillow's price different"
When we go on Zillow's website, this is their explanation
"The Zestimate® home value is Zillow's estimated market value for an individual home and is calculated for about 100 million homes nationwide. It is a starting point in determining a home's value and is not an official appraisal. The Zestimate is automatically computed three times per week based on millions of public and user-submitted data points."

To make it more understandable when a hoem is estimated to have a value of  at $500,000 and the ZESTIMATE is off by 10% that's a difference of $50,000!
So if the house is under priced you are missing out on thousands of dollars. By the same token if it is OVERPRICED by 10%  you are missing out on the market, by stting a awhile and then having to drop the price, making the buyers wonder what's wrong with the house, when in fact there is nothing wrong.

Remember Zillow does not take features, updates on your property and compare them to the closed homes in your area. Even though doing those gives you a more updated value on your property.
Zillow does not walk through your home, look at all your unique features, upgrades and place an accurate current value.
